munificent (oh)
[Date: 1500-1600; Origin: munificence (1500-1600), from Latin munificentia, from munificus 'generous', from munus; MUNICIPAL]
very generous
::a munificent gift
-- munificence n [U]
::the munificence of the museum's benefactors
muralled (iou)
muralled adjective. E18.
[from MURAL adjective, noun + -ED2.]
Used for or made into a mural crown. rare. E18.
J. P. Philips Ardent to deck his brows with mural'd gold, Or civic wreath of oak.
Decorated with murals. M20.
A. West Stella watched the shadows..as they bobbed on the muralled wall.
